Robinio Vaz suffers knee injury in Roma training session

Robinio Vaz sustained a collateral ligament injury to his knee during Roma's first training session of the season on July 13. The 2007-born French forward, who joined from Marseille in January, is expected to miss several weeks, including the initial home friendlies. His recovery timeline could allow a return by August 1 for a friendly against Cardiff. Manager Gian Piero Gasperini is reportedly looking for more experienced players, indicating Vaz's role may be uncertain moving forward.
